In Kerkrade, old meets new. Unique in the Netherlands is Rolduc Abbey, the largest and oldest preserved abbey complex in the country. Besides this heritage gem, you can visit other top attractions such as GaiaZOO, one of the best zoos in the Netherlands, and Discovery Museum, the discovery museum for young and old. Nearby, get on the Miljoenenlijn for a nostalgic steam train ride through Heuvelland during special driving days.
Kerkrade is also the birthplace of the now-defunct coal industry. Traces of the mining era (and beyond) that are worth exploring are Schacht Nulland, the Botanical Garden, Parc Gravenrode and the many music festivals. Will you say hello to D'r Joep at the market?

Since 1 January 2021, the rules for your home's energy label have become stricter.
If you are going to sell or rent out your property, an energy label is mandatory!
You used to be able to apply for an energy label online very easily for a few euros.
Under the new rules, it is mandatory to have an energy consultant visit your home for inspection.
During this inspection, the consultant assesses how much energy your home uses, how much of that is renewable energy and how much fossil energy is used after that.
An energy label is then calculated based on this information.
